What type of stretches should beginners incorporate for Flexibility, according to canfitpro?

  1. Easy-to-accomplish stretches, held statically for at least 20 to 30 seconds each

  2. Dynamic stretches only

  3. Ballistic stretches

  4. Advanced yoga poses

The correct answer is: Easy-to-accomplish stretches, held statically for at least 20 to 30 seconds each

It is important for beginners to incorporate easy-to-accomplish stretches that are held statically for at least 20 to 30 seconds. This helps to gradually improve flexibility without risking injury. Dynamic stretches, while beneficial for warming up, may be too challenging for beginners. Ballistic stretches involve bouncing or rapid movements, which can also be risky for those who are new to stretching. Advanced yoga poses require a significant amount of strength and flexibility, making them unsuitable for beginners. Therefore, option A is the most appropriate choice for beginners to incorporate in their flexibility routine.
